Theron also described the moments before the confrontation, explaining she had run into the house without greeting her father.
She added: “I had to pee really badly. So I ran into the house to get to the toilet, and he took that as me being rude, because I didn’t stop and say hello to everybody.
“Big thing in South Africa, the kind of respect that you have to have for elders. “And he was in a state where he just spiralled. Like: ‘Why didn’t you stop? Who do you think you are?’”
Theron said she later went to her room, fearing further conflict.
She added: “I knew he was mad at me. So I said to [my mother], ‘When he eventually decides to come home, please tell him I’m asleep’.
“I went into my room, I turned my lights off, and I was scared.”
She went on: “My window faced the driveway, and I could tell the level of anger, frustration, or unhappiness by the way he drove in.”
Theron also said she “just knew something bad was going to happen”.
She described her father forcing entry and firing shots.
Theron said: “The two of us were holding the door with our bodies because there wasn’t a lock on it. He just stepped back and started shooting through the door.”
But she added: “Not one bullet hit us.”
Theron said her mother retrieved a firearm and responded.
She said: “The messaging was very clear: ‘I’m going to kill you tonight. You think I can’t come into this door? Watch me. I’m going to go to the safe. I’m going to get the shotgun.’”
She said her father and uncle, who had allegedly accompanied Charles, were both shot.
Theron added: “He walked to the safe, and my mom pulled the door open while the brother was still standing there.
“The brother ran down the hallway, and she shot one bullet down the hallway that ricocheted seven times and shot him in the hand. It’s stuff you can’t explain. And then she followed my father, who was by then opening the safe to get more weapons out, and she shot him.”
She said after the incident, her mother continued with daily life.
“The next morning she sent me to school. She was just like, ‘we’re going to move on’,” Theron said.
“Not necessarily the healthiest thing, but it worked for us.”
